As I’d blogged earlier about the new dean for Faculty of Engineering (FOE), Faculty of Information of Technology (FIT) also had management changed with the appointment of a new dean as well. Previous dean, Assoc. Prof. Dr. Ewe Hong Tat has began his new post as the Acting Vice President (Academic) of MMU and the new dean for FIT is Dr. Ho Chin Kuan.

After some recollection of memories, I managed to recall the list of FIT deans since the establishment of MMU-FIT. And it would be nice to share with you all the deans of FIT.
NOTE: I may get the wrong time line.
Prof. Lee Poh Aun (1997-2000)
Prof. Chuah Hean Teik (Acting: 2000-2001)
Assoc. Prof. Dr. Ewe Hong Tat (2001-2008)
Dr. Ho Chin Kuan (2008-present)
